Mid-West Female Illustrator Robin Artine Smith depicts a female
swimmer running from the beach into the water. The poster-like graphic
image captures a peak moment of pure fun and joy, with the 1940-era
blonde subject's smile shining brighter than the summer sun. Unsigned.

Painter, Designer, Illustrator born on July 18, 1903 in Warren
Arkansas. Studied at the Chicago Art Institute; Northwestern University;
Vienne, Austria; with Eliot O’Hara and Hubert Ropp. Member of the
following organizations: Dallas Art Association; Texas Fine Arts
Association; National Association of Watercolor Artists; and the Texas
watercolor Society. Smith exhibited at: American Watercolor Society in
1945, 1948 and 1952; with National Assn. of Watercolor Artists in 1945,
1946, and 1948; Artists Alliance in Dallas in 1943 (awarded prize), in
1944 (awarded prize), in 1945-46 and 1948-1950, 1952-53 with prizes
awarded in 1948 and 1953; the Texas General Exhibition from 1943 through
1946, 1948-49; with the Texas Watercolor Society from 1950-52 with
prizes won in 1950 and 1951, 1957; with the Southern States Arts League
in 1944 and 1945; Texas Fine Arts Association in 1945 and awarded prize
and with the Texas Artist Group consecutively from 1945.Smith’s work is
in the collection of the Dallas Museum of Fine Arts.


Her one-woman shows were in Austin, Texas in 1948; in San Antonio in 1951 and Dallas in 1951. Smith’s work is in the collection of the Dallas Museum of Fine Arts.
